In that sense, using +this code is no different than handcoding HTML. + +************************************************** +A NOTE ABOUT PROCEDURE NAMES +************************************************** + +All procedures are named cgi_XXX. You can also call them without the +cgi_ prefix. Using the cgi_XXX form is no big deal for rarely used +procedures, but the aliases are particularly convenient for things +like hr and br. Aliases are suppressed if procedures exist by those +names already. (Thus, cgi_eval cannot be invoked as "eval"!) +Similarly, you can overwrite the aliases with impunity. Internally, +references are only made to the cgi_ names. + +I'm still thinking about this. If you have strong feelings about it, +let me know. + +************************************************** +SECURITY +************************************************** + +I frequently see statements saying that Tcl (and other interpretive +languages, for that matter) are insecure and should not be used for +writing CGI. + +I disagree. It is possible to use Tcl securely and it really isn't +very hard. The key, of course, is to not blindly evaluate user input. +There really isn't much reason to. For instance, this library itself +is pretty big and does lots of things, but nothing in it evaluates +user input. (It does do a lot of evaluation of *programmer* input, +but that's quite acceptable.) + +The two classes of commands you should pay close attention to are +commands that do eval operations and commands that invoke external +programs. + +************************************************** +GENERAL NOTES ABOUT PARAMETERS +************************************************** + +** There are several basic styles of parameter passing. + +-- Container commands (e.g., ,

Here is +an example: + + cgi_text age=18 onChange=MinimumAge(this.form.age) + +************************************************** +PROCEDURES TO ASSIST IN DEBUGGING +************************************************** + +** User-id differences + +You can interactively run and debug CGI scripts by simply running them +from the shell, or a Tcl or C debugger. (For convenience, I use +Expect instead of tclsh just so that I get the debugger.) In fact, +I've never had to resort to the C debugger. However, simply watching +the raw output from a shell is very handy. This catches the really +basic errors such as incorrect protections, incorrect #! line, etc. +Once your script is actually executing, you can rely on cgi_eval (see +below). + +cgi_uid_check user + +Typically, a CGI script is intended to run from a particular uid, such +as "nobody". If you run such scripts interactively, you can end up +with conflicts. For example, if the script creates files, files can +accidentally end up being owned by you. + +cgi_uid_check is a convenient mechanism to warn against this problem. +Simply call cgi_uid_check in your script. The argument is the uid +under which the script should be running. If the given uid does +not match the actual uid, cgi_uid_check will generate an error. + +** Trapping error messages + +cgi_eval + +cgi_eval is the primary error catching/reporting mechanism. Execute +commands from cgi_eval so that errors can be caught and reported in a +nice way. By default, errors are emailed back to the administrator. +"cgi_debug -on" makes errors be immediately viewable in the browser. + +If an error is caught when debugging is enabled, the diagnostic is +anchored with #cgierror. This is useful in scripts that produce +voluminous output. + +cgi_error_occurred + +cgi_error_occurred returns 1 if an error occurred and was caught by +cgi_eval. This separate function simplifies exit handling - for +example, rather than always checking the return value of cgi_eval, an +app can just test this from a redefined exit. + +cgi_admin_mail_addr addr + +cgi_admin_mail_addr sets the administrator's email address. +Diagnostics are sent via email if a problem is encountered with the +script and debugging is not enabled. + +cgi_name name + +cgi_name defines a name for the service. If called with no arguments, +the name is returned. The name is currently used in the following +places: + + If email is sent, it comes from [cgi_name]. + If errors are emailed, the subject is "[cgi_name]: CGI problem" + +** Generating debugging output and other commands + +cgi_debug args + +cgi_debug provides rudimentary support for generating debugging +messages. Here are some example calls: + +cgi_debug cmd + If debugging is on, the command is evaluated. For example: + + cgi_debug { + h2 "completed initialization" + } + or + cgi_debug {h2 "completed initialization"} + + Note this is more than simply calling h2. Context is rewound + or forwarded to get to a place where this is safe. (And + conversely, this call can suppress things such as header + elements that haven't been processed yet.) The flag + "-noprint" suppresses this manipulation - this is useful for + early code that causes no printing. + + The -- flag causes the next argument to treated as a command + even if it looks like another flag. +cgi_debug -on + Enables debugging messages. This includes debugging messages + generated by explicit calls to cgi_debug as well as implicit + diagnostics, for example, that report on form input. +cgi_debug -temp text + Enable debugging for this one line. +cgi_debug -off + Disable debugging. + +cgi_debug always returns the old setting ("-on" or "-off"). The +initial value is -off. + + +** Printing arrays + +cgi_parray arrayname + +cgi_parray prints out the elements of a Tcl array. cgi_parray is just +like Tcl's parray except that its output is appropriately formatted +for a browser. + +************************************************** +BASIC STRUCTURE OF A CGI SCRIPT +************************************************** + +Typically, the basic structure of most CGI scripts is: + + package require cgi + + cgi_eval { + cgi_http_head {cmds} + cgi_html { + cgi_head {cmds} + cgi_body {cmds} + } + } + +Much of this can be omitted, however. In fact, a typical script looks +more like this: + + package require cgi + + cgi_eval { + cgi_title "title" + cgi_body { + cmds + } + } + +(If you're not using the Tcl package support, replace the 'package +require' command with a 'source' command of the specific file +containing the cgi.tcl source.) + +(The "...." in the examples above should be replaced by the true path +to the cgi.tcl file.) + +I'll now go through each of these in more detail as well as some other +possibilities for the overall structure. + +************************************************** +HTTP HEADERS +************************************************** + +cgi_http_head cmds + +CGI scripts must produce various headers to explain how the remainder +of the output is to be interpreted. No other output may preceed this! + +With no argument, an HTML content type is produced if the script is +running in the CGI environment. This means that most people need not +bother calling cgi_http_head. However, if you want to see the HTTP +headers and you are not running in the CGI environment, you should +call cgi_http_head explicitly. (Alternatively, you can make it appear +that you are in the CGI environment by defining the environment +variable REQUEST_METHOD.) + +The remaining commands in this section may be used in cgi_http_head. +Most should be intuitively obvious and thus need no explanation. + +cgi_content_type type + Generates a "Content-type:" header. + +With no argument, cgi_content_type generates a declaration for HTML. +If specified, the 'type' argument should be the full MIME-style +type/subtype declaration. Any MIME-style parameters should be +included in the type argument. + +cgi_redirect location + Generates a redirect header (Status:/Location:/URI:) +cgi_target + Generates a "Window-target:" header. +cgi_refresh seconds url + Generates a "Refresh:" header. The url argument is optional. +cgi_pragma pragma + Generates a "Pragma:" header. +cgi_status number string + Generates a "Status:" header. + +** Cookies + +cgi_cookie_set name=val args + Define a cookie with given name, value, and other arguments. + Cookie values are automatically encoded to protect odd characters. + A couple expirations are predefined (with intuitive meaning): + expires=never + expires=now + expires=...actual date... + + Here are some examples: + cgi_cookie_set user=don domain=nist.gov expires=never + cgi_cookie_set user=don expires=now secure + +cgi_export_cookie name args + Export the named Tcl variable as a cookie. Other arguments are + processed as with cgi_cookie_set. + +Cookies may be read only after calling cgi_input. The following +routines read cookie names or specific cookies. + +cgi_cookie_list + Returns the list of all cookies supplied by the server. + +cgi_cookie_get name + Returns the value of the named cookie. If multiple values exists + the most specific path mapping is used. + + If the "-all" flag is used (before the cookie name), a list is + returned containing all cookie values for the given name. The + list is ordered most-specific (path mapping) to least. I.e., + the first value on the list is the same one returned by + calling cgi_cookie get without a flag. + +cgi_import_cookie name + Define a Tcl variable with the value of the cookie of the same + name. For example, the following command retrieves the cookie + named "Password" and stores it in the Tcl variable "Password". + + cgi_import_cookie Password + + +************************************************** +GENERATING HTML +************************************************** + +cgi_html + + tags can be generated using cgi_html.
